Skip to content

Instantly share code, notes, and snippets.

Show Gist options
  • Save parallaxhub/bd96bf450bf4bf1eec7e58256f4e79a9 to your computer and use it in GitHub Desktop.
Save parallaxhub/bd96bf450bf4bf1eec7e58256f4e79a9 to your computer and use it in GitHub Desktop.
Things To Do After Installing Ubuntu 20.04 LTS Cloud Server
sudo -i
apt update -y
apt-get upgrade -y
apt update -y
apt install build-essential checkinstall
apt install ubuntu-restricted-extras
apt install software-properties-common
apt install apt-show-versions
apt upgrade -o APT::Get::Show-Upgraded=true
apt-show-versions | grep upgradeable
apt update -y
apt-get upgrade -y
add-apt-repository ppa:nilarimogard/webupd8
apt update -y
apt install launchpad-getkeys
launchpad-getkeys
add-apt-repository ppa:git-core/ppa
apt update -y
apt install git
git config --global user.name "name"
git config --global user.email mail@domain.com
ssh-keygen -t rsa -b 4096 -C "email@gmail.com"
eval "$(ssh-agent -s)"
ssh-add ~/.ssh/id_rsa
# Add SSH Key the GitHub
cat /root/.ssh/id_rsa.pub
apt upgrade -y && apt update
apt-get install openssh-server
nano /etc/ssh/sshd_config
# Find (ctrl+w) this line and set
PermitRootLogin yes
PubkeyAuthentication yes
PasswordAuthentication yes
# Save & exit ctrl+s and ctrl+x then hit enter
service ssh restart
apt upgrade -y && apt update
apt -f install && apt autoremove
apt -y autoclean && apt -y clean
apt upgrade -y && apt update
reboot
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ment